// Hey, welcome to the Pairwise matching service! Quick heads-up: the GC
// pauses here are the main reason match latency spikes during evening peaks.
// We tuned the heap sizes and pause targets by trial and error on the
// Gravelton staging cluster, so don't change these casually — a 50ms pause
// can drop a whole batch of candidate pairs. The constants below are what
// we settled on after the March load tests.

tuning table, yajog-yahof:
BUDGETS = {
    "lamvan": 303,
    "wenox": 460,
    "fenvan": 525,
}

# Training Budget — Next Fiscal Year

**Restricted: Managers only**

The proposed training allocation rises modestly, weighted toward the Orvane platform certification and leadership coaching for the Selbury site. Departmental caps remain, with unspent funds returning centrally at year-end rather than rolling over. Approval routing stays with divisional managers. For the incoming director, the strategic reasoning behind these choices appears below.

internal memo for kaduf-baduf: Only 35 of the 378 pilot accounts renewed Holir, so a churn review is set for June 11. Eliielax Group is in early talks to buy Silaelix Group for about $142.1 million.

Handover: Widediff maintenance

I'm passing Widediff, our large-file diff viewer, to you as of this sprint. The chunked rendering path is stable, but the memory-mapped tokenizer still needs careful watching under files over 4 GB. Tashi left thorough comments in the core module. When redeploying, apply the service configuration exactly as it appears in the block below.

settings of yahig-baweg:
[istael]
host = istael.qorvellabs.corp
user = istael_svc
database = istael_prod

### Step 6: Reconfigure the nightly reindex

After cutting over to the new Fernstack cluster, the nightly search reindex must be repointed before the next scheduled run, or it will rebuild against the decommissioned shards. Update the scheduler first, then the index writer, in that order — the reverse order can leave a half-built index that serves empty results. Once both are updated, confirm the job picks up the settings shown below.

deployment values, yadug-bawif:
[framir]
team = pelox
access_code = ac_a38ab2
owner = tamion.julael
host = framir.tolvaqlabs.test
port = 11211
peer = tammir.zemvargrid.local
salt = 2215ef03
pin = 1541